cloud_firestore_odm 1.0.0-dev.88 copy "cloud_firestore_odm: ^1.0.0-dev.88" to clipboard
cloud_firestore_odm: ^1.0.0-dev.88 copied to clipboard

An ODM for Firebase Cloud Firestore (cloud_firestore).

1.0.0-dev.88 #

  • BREAKING: Removes set methods from FirestoreDocumentReference to make way for generated methods

1.0.0-dev.87 - 2024-07-08 #

1.0.0-dev.86 - 2024-06-09 #

  • Bumped minimum cloud_firestore version to 5.0.0

1.0.0-dev.84 - 2024-03-04 #

  • Bumped minimum cloud_firestore version to 4.15.0

1.0.0-dev.83 - 2024-01-25 #

  • Update generated code to support recent Firestore query changes

1.0.0-dev.82 #

  • Update a dependency to the latest release.

1.0.0-dev.81 #

  • Update a dependency to the latest release.

1.0.0-dev.80 #

  • Update a dependency to the latest release.

1.0.0-dev.79 #

  • Update a dependency to the latest release.

1.0.0-dev.78 #

  • Update a dependency to the latest release.

1.0.0-dev.77 #

  • Update a dependency to the latest release.

1.0.0-dev.76 #

  • Update a dependency to the latest release.

1.0.0-dev.75 #

  • Update a dependency to the latest release.

1.0.0-dev.74 #

  • Update a dependency to the latest release.

1.0.0-dev.73 #

  • Update a dependency to the latest release.

1.0.0-dev.72 #

1.0.0-dev.71 #

  • Update a dependency to the latest release.

1.0.0-dev.70 #

  • FEAT(cloud_firestore_odm_generator): Support all serializable types (#11365). (f4c21f83)

1.0.0-dev.69 #

  • Update a dependency to the latest release.

1.0.0-dev.68 #

  • Update a dependency to the latest release.

1.0.0-dev.67 #

  • Update a dependency to the latest release.

1.0.0-dev.66 #

  • Update a dependency to the latest release.

1.0.0-dev.65 #

  • FEAT(cloud_firestore_odm_generator): Support Sets as well as Lists for query method generation (#11361). (d60cfe63)

1.0.0-dev.64 #

  • Update a dependency to the latest release.

1.0.0-dev.63 #

  • Update a dependency to the latest release.

1.0.0-dev.62 #

  • Update a dependency to the latest release.

1.0.0-dev.61 #

  • Update a dependency to the latest release.

1.0.0-dev.60 #

1.0.0-dev.59 #

  • FIX(odm_generator): update deprecated check isDynamic (#10937). (bb9c5523)

1.0.0-dev.58 #

  • FEAT: update dependency constraints to sdk: '>=2.18.0 <4.0.0' flutter: '>=3.3.0' (#10946). (2772d10f)

1.0.0-dev.57 #

  • FEAT: upgrade to dart 3 compatible dependencies (#10890). (4bd7e59b)

1.0.0-dev.56 #

  • Update a dependency to the latest release.

1.0.0-dev.55 #

  • Update a dependency to the latest release.

1.0.0-dev.54 #

  • Update a dependency to the latest release.

1.0.0-dev.53 #

1.0.0-dev.52 #

  • Update a dependency to the latest release.

1.0.0-dev.51 #

  • Update a dependency to the latest release.

1.0.0-dev.50 #

  • Update a dependency to the latest release.

1.0.0-dev.49 #

  • Update a dependency to the latest release.

1.0.0-dev.48 #

  • Update a dependency to the latest release.

1.0.0-dev.47 #

  • Update a dependency to the latest release.

1.0.0-dev.46 #

  • REFACTOR: upgrade project to remove warnings from Flutter 3.7 (#10344). (e0087c84)

1.0.0-dev.45 #

  • Update a dependency to the latest release.

1.0.0-dev.44 #

  • Update a dependency to the latest release.

1.0.0-dev.43 #

  • Update a dependency to the latest release.

1.0.0-dev.42 #

  • FIX: a bug where the ODM does not respect JSON case renaming (#9988). (02d394b6)

1.0.0-dev.41 #

  • Update a dependency to the latest release.

1.0.0-dev.40 #

  • FIX: Improve error handling if a collection and the associated model are defined in separate files. (#9827). (294e1085)

1.0.0-dev.39 #

  • Update a dependency to the latest release.

1.0.0-dev.38 #

  • Update a dependency to the latest release.

1.0.0-dev.37 #

  • FIX: The ODM correctly no-longer generates query utilities for getters. (#9766). (cfb56939)

1.0.0-dev.36 #

  • Update a dependency to the latest release.

1.0.0-dev.35 #

  • FEAT: Add support for FirebaseFirestore.myNamedQueryGet() (#9721). (82152a00)

1.0.0-dev.34 #

1.0.0-dev.33 #

1.0.0-dev.32 #

  • FEAT: Allow injecting the document ID in the ODM model (#9600). (c7e93cfe)

1.0.0-dev.31 #

  • FIX: handle query.orderBy(startAt:).orderBy() (#9185). (62396e8a)

1.0.0-dev.30 #

  • FEAT: add support for specifying class name prefix (#9453). (49921a43)

1.0.0-dev.29 #

  • FEAT: Add support using Freezed classes as collection models (#9483). (ce238f71)

1.0.0-dev.28 #

  • Update a dependency to the latest release.

1.0.0-dev.27 #

  • Update a dependency to the latest release.

1.0.0-dev.26 #

  • Update a dependency to the latest release.

1.0.0-dev.25 #

  • Update a dependency to the latest release.

1.0.0-dev.24 #

Note: This release has breaking changes.

  • FIX: Correctly type firestoreJsonConverters as List<JsonConverter> instead of List<Object> (#9236). (b39d87c7)
  • FEAT: Add where(arrayContains) support (#9167). (1a2f2262)
  • BREAKING FEAT: The low-level interface of Queries/Document (#9184). (fad4b0cd)

1.0.0-dev.23 #

  • Update a dependency to the latest release.

1.0.0-dev.22 #

  • Update a dependency to the latest release.

1.0.0-dev.21 #

  • FEAT: add orderByFieldPath / whereFieldPath (#8951). (5957c23b)
  • FEAT: Add support for DateTime/Timestamp/GeoPoint (#8563). (f2ea3696)
  • FEAT: add support for json_serializable's field rename/property ignore (#9030). (81ec08fd)

1.0.0-dev.20 #

  • Update a dependency to the latest release.

1.0.0-dev.19 #

  • FEAT: add whereDocumentId/orderByDocumentId (#8935). (3769bcca)

1.0.0-dev.18 #

  • REFACTOR: use "firebase" instead of "FirebaseExtended" as organisation in all links for this repository (#8791). (d90b8357)

1.0.0-dev.17 #

  • Update a dependency to the latest release.

1.0.0-dev.16 #

  • Update a dependency to the latest release.

1.0.0-dev.15 #

  • FEAT: Assert that collection.doc(id) does not point to a separate collection (#8676). (0808205b)

1.0.0-dev.14 #

  • Update a dependency to the latest release.

1.0.0-dev.13 #

  • FEAT: upgrade analyzer, freezed_annotation and json_serializable dependencies (#8465). (8a27ab21)

1.0.0-dev.12 #

  • Update a dependency to the latest release.

1.0.0-dev.11 #

  • Update a dependency to the latest release.

1.0.0-dev.10 #

  • FIX: update all Dart SDK version constraints to Dart >= 2.16.0 (#8184). (df4a5bab)

1.0.0-dev.9 #

  • Update a dependency to the latest release.

1.0.0-dev.8 #

  • DOCS: Update code snippets by removing incorrect forward slash for @Collection annotations. (#8044). (292f20c6)

1.0.0-dev.7 #

  • Update a dependency to the latest release.

1.0.0-dev.6 #

  • Update a dependency to the latest release.

1.0.0-dev.5 #

  • Update a dependency to the latest release.

1.0.0-dev.4 #

  • Update a dependency to the latest release.

1.0.0-dev.3 #

  • Update a dependency to the latest release.

1.0.0-dev.2 #

  • Update a dependency to the latest release.

1.0.0-dev.1 #

  • Initial preview release.